Not sure if I did the tests right, but here it is. I did the following:

- installed the stock amavisd-new on Intrepid, sent a test mail, and got a bounce back to the sender.
- removed amavisd-new with purge
- enabled intrepid-proposed, installed amavisd-new from there, checked the conf, the two options were gone
- sent the same test mail (with attached virus), and got back bounce message, because of this, I think:

root at utest-ii:/etc/amavis/conf.d# cat /etc/amavis/conf.d/21-ubuntu_defaults |grep banned_dest
$final_banned_destiny     = D_BOUNCE;  # (defaults to D_BOUNCE)

This would still bounce back a message to the sender. After changing
this to D_DISCARD, I didn't get back any bounce mail. Double-checked the
config file is indeed installed by the package from -proposed.
